Seminar contents:
Be an English Teaching Pioneer!
- Observation of Little America classes
- Reviewing TEMI teaching methods
- How to use materials and games
- Discussion both in English and Japanese
- Reviewing the pilot program of a local elementary school
- Consultation with Helene J. Uchida
- Learning techniques for disciplining and motivating your students
- Learn songs, dances and activities appropriate for preschool and elementary school
TEMI Precious Pioneer Seminars are weekend seminars for dedicated teachers who are eager to learn and use innovative and meaningful techniques to improve the quality and enjoyment level of their preschool and elementary school English classes. There is a Pioneer Seminar in Fukuoka every three months, so there are plenty of opportunities to attend!
In addition, please feel free to contact us if your group would like a Precious Pioneer Seminar focusing on teaching English in junior high or high school. We can tailor our Pioneer Seminars to your group's specific needs.
